LED Grille; Fits 20 in. E-Series LED Light; Light Sold Separately; [Available While Supplies Last];


SPECIFICATIONS:
  • Finish: Black Powder Coat
  • Material: Stainless Steel
  • Position: Front
  • Style: Mesh
  • WARNING CA Proposition 65: No

FEATURES:
  • One Of The Most Requested Grilles By Rigid Nation
  • 100 Percent Stainless Steel
  • Custom Laser Cut Mesh Pattern
  • Grille Emblem Included

2007-2014 JK Wrangler LED Grille fits a 20" Rigid E-Series LED Light. The custom laser-cut mesh pattern stainless steel, no weld, polyester powder coated grille includes stainless steel hardware, grille emblem and is made in the U.S.A.
